Popular Credit Card Offers

A quick survey of credit card vendors shows there are some common categories for card offers. We'll have a quick look at the usual suspects:

Cash Back Cards ? Cash back cards are becoming more and more common. Every major vendor offers them, and you can earn as much as 5% back on specific purchases. Many cards focus on particular types of spending habits (gas, entertainment, everyday purchases, etc). Have an idea of what your money is most frequently going toward to maximize your return on these great cards.

Airline Miles Cards ? Ah, yes, the ubiquitous frequent flyer cards. These cards were all the rage in the 1990's, and they are still quite popular today. Frequent flyer cards operate much like cash back card offers, except your rewards are obviously tallied in rewards miles. Be sure to read the fine print to uncover flight restrictions and bonus plans. Airline cards more typically have annual fees, but for heavy users these plans more than pay for themselves.

Balance Transfer/Low APR Cards ? This is the way to go for the fiscally minded among us. If you tend to carry a balance on your card, then getting into a nice balance transfer or low APR card can drastically cut your monthly payments. The vast majority of balance transfer cards give you a 0% APR grace period, and a typically low APR after that. This should give you a nice chance to pay down your debt without paying more interest than necessary.

Bad Credit Credit Cards ? These cards, when used wisely, can be a great tool for improving your credit score. Now, naturally, bad credit credit cards do not typically come with many bells and whistles, but there are still some great options out there. Check out Orchard Bank's Platinum or Gold cards. The other option to consider is a Secured Card. A secured card requires you to establish a savings account for collateral, and that you pay your balance in full each month. If you do that for a while you can work your way into something more traditional.

Instant Approval Offers ? The name explains it all. Instant approval cards offer a quick and easy opportunity to get you started. You can apply online and usually receive a credit decision within seconds of filling out an online credit card application. There are many banks that offer instant approval.

Following are some suggestions to think about as you study online credit card offers.

Know your Style

Before signing up for a card, think about your money habits. Everyone has a different spending style, and that can affect what kind of credit card you need. If you grew up in a household where savings was stressed, you may be used to staying debt-free. A credit card offer with a rewards program could be perfect for you. If you come from a high-spending background, you might be more inclined to shopping sprees. Low interest rates will help you keep debt in check if you regularly carry a balance on your credit card.

Recognize your Choices

Understanding your spending style will allow you to set priorities. Think about what is most important for your financial position. Then look for a card that will benefit you most. Here are some of the features you can choose from in online credit card offers:

Annual Percentage Rate (APR): APR refers to the cost of credit. It is presented as a percentage rate. Many online credit card offers come with an initial low or interest-free period. When that ends, a different, often higher, APR will set in. If you plan to have a card for a long time or carry a balance, a low APR will help you out.

Balance Transfer: Some credit card offers allow you to shift the balance on your current credit card over to the new one. This can be a way to get rid of outstanding debt. If the card offers a 0% APR introductory period on the balance transfer, you have some time to pay down the debt. You can get rid of the balance in a few months, and save yourself valuable money on interest.

Rewards: Many credit card offers include cash back bonuses, travel rewards, or gas rebates. If you use the credit card for daily expenses, and then pay off the balance each month, this type of card is perfect for you. Check the fine print to make sure you understand how the program works.

Additional benefits: Some cards include extra features, such as travel insurance or custom designs. Others offer no annual fee. Still others, like bad credit credit cards, focus on helping you rebuild your credit score. Be aware of these benefits as you look through the various credit card offers.
